I'm trying to reply to a pm but by the time I'm finished, after I hit the "submit" button, it's like SR has logged me off and my pm is gone. It tells me I'm not logged in! This has hapened twice! Is it because my message is long? It's so aggravating to be typing and typing and then it's gone! HELP!

The only suggestion I can offer to solve it is to check the "Remember Me" box when you log in. This will often keep you from timing out and keep you logged in if you are having that problem.

The other choice is to copy your post before hitting submit. If it doesn't work paste it in again and submit it.
